This champagne is made from the purest grape juice, enabling Laurent-Perrier to create “La Cuvée” in magnum, a wine of great finesse and freshness, patiently developed through long cellar aging.
The choice of a high percentage of Chardonnay defines the style and personality of Maison Laurent-Perrier. Purity, freshness and elegance are the watchwords of this emblematic cuvée, a true initiation to the spirit of the House.

Robe
The magnum of La Cuvée Laurent-Perrier reveals a pale gold color with crystalline reflections, sublimated by a fine, persistent effervescence. The full, even foam cordon reflects the meticulous attention to detail at every stage of production.
Nose
The nose opens with delicate aromas of citrus and white flowers, offering an immediate sensation of freshness. In the background, subtle notes of vine peach and white-fleshed fruit bring complexity and richness, testifying to the maturity of the wines used in the blend.
Palate
The palate is lively and elegant. Fruity flavors unfold harmoniously, carried by the characteristic finesse of Chardonnay. The finish is long and airy, seductive in its lightness and persistent freshness.

Located in the heart of the charming village of Tours-sur-Marne, Maison Laurent-Perrier relies on a high-quality vineyard, complemented by long-term partnerships with selected winemakers from the most prestigious terroirs of the Montagne de Reims, Vallée de la Marne and Côte des Blancs.
Bernard de Nonancourt is the creator of the Laurent-Perrier style. Drawing on the traditions of the Champagne region, while infusing bold technical innovations, he has fashioned a range of singular wines, each with its own history and style.
To sublimate his champagnes, he imagines unique and original bottles. Grand Siècle inaugurates this approach, with a bottle inspired by the 17th-century bottles that contained the first champagne wines.
Stéphanie Le Quellec, Michelin-starred chef at La Scène, the gastronomic restaurant of the Prince of Wales in Paris, unveils her signature dish in harmony with "La Cuvée" from Champagne Laurent-Perrier:
a lightly seared langoustine with vanilla and buckwheat, accompanied by its blancmange.
